Aeffe shares fall after applying for negotiated settlement procedure

By Ansa Published October 3, 2025 Aeffe has tumbled on the stock market. Shares in the group, which counts Alberta Ferretti, Moschino and Pollini among its brands, fell 10.4% to €0.40 following its request to enter the negotiated settlement procedure. Trump obtains another settlement as YouTube agrees to pay $24.5 million

Google owner Alphabet today agreed to pay $24.5 million to settle a lawsuit that President Trump filed against YouTube in 2021. Trump sued YouTube over his account being suspended after Trump supporters’ January 6 attack on the US Capitol. Alphabet agreed to pay $22 million “to settle and resolve with Plaintiff Donald J. YouTube caves to Trump with $24.5 million settlement

YouTube has settled a lawsuit President Donald Trump filed against the company in 2021, according to The Wall Street Journal. Trump filed sweeping lawsuits against Google-owned YouTube, Meta (then Facebook) and X (then Twitter) after he was suspended from the platforms, and now all three companies have settled with the president.
